Who is Rose Hanbury?
🤢😏😑 Rose Hanbury is the Marchioness of Cholmondeley and is the daughter of Timothy Hanbury, a website designer, and Emma Hanbury, a fashion designer.
🤢😏😑 She was a boarder at the prestigious Stowe School, before completing an Open University degree.
🤢😏😑 Rose went on to become a fashion model in her 20s when she reportedly had a contract with Storm - the agency which discovered Kate Moss.
🤢😏😑 She first came to national attention in 2005 when she and her elder sister Marina - both wearing pink bikinis - posed alongside a grinning Mr Blair.
🤢😏😑 Rose also worked as a political researcher for Tory MP Michael Gove.
Is Rose Hanbury married?
🤢😏😑 Rose married David Rocksavage, 7th Marquess of Cholmondeley, in 2009.
🤢😏😑 The pair first met on holiday in Italy in 2003 and were wed at Chelsea Town Hall in 2009 after a very brief engagement.

🤢😏😑 According to Hello, "in June 2009 the couple announced their engagement, the next day it was revealed they were expecting and just a day later they tied the knot".
🤢😏😑 David is a descendent of Sir Robert Walpole and is also related to the Rothschild and Sassoon families.
🤢😏😑 The couple has twin boys, Alexander, Earl of Rocksavage and Oliver, Lord Cholmondeley, and daughter Lady Iris.
🤢😏😑 The boys are reportedly playmates of Prince George.
🤢😏😑 There is a 23-year age gap between the couple.
🤢😏😑 The couple is worth an estimated £112million.
How does Rose Hanbury know Prince William and Kate Middleton?
🤢😏😑 Hanbury lives in Houghton Hall, Norfolk, alongside her family and husband.
🤢😏😑 The property was built in the 1700s for Britain’s first Prime Minister, Sir Robert Walpole, and is located just a few miles away from Will and Kate's home, Anmer Hall.
🤢😏😑 Given their proximity to one another the couples reportedly run in the same social circle.
🤢😏😑 The pair's warm greetings to each other at a gala in 2016 confirmed their tight-knit relationship, as Hanbury later attended the banquet in honour of President Trump's state visit to the UK and was seated near William and Kate.

🤢😏😑 The two couples are thought to have regularly double-dated and are both patrons of the East Anglia Children’s Hospice.
🤢😏😑 Rose's grandmother and namesake Lady Rose Lambert was a bridesmaid in Queen Elizabeth's wedding to Prince Philip, further cementing her connection to the Royal Family.
